Creation of a new health and social service "Patronage care" - to the Municipality of Breznik

The aim of the Project is to enhance the quality of life and increase the social inclusion of people with disabilities and elderly people trough establishing of network of home-based social services and provision of adequate (material and staffing) capacity for providing them. In connection to the unprecedented challenges associated with the pandemic outbreak of COVID 19, additional resource are needed to prevent and secure access to services for vulnerable person, incl. people with disabilities or with need of support for self-care who are most at risk of COVID 19, as well as persons in quarantine. It has been identified increased need for the provision of home services in the context of emerging epidemic situation in the country. The project activities are directed to provision of hourly services to the persons with social need for such and thus protecting the public interest and meeting the needs of the population to prevent the spread of COVID 19.
